GRID Pilot Phase 1985-87: Final Report - GRID Information Series No. 14

ThiS pilot phase of GRID had four objectives; The development of geographic information systems (GIS) methodologies and procedures for constructing, manipulating and making available to users global environmental data sets for the purpose of conducting environmental analyses and assessments; Demonstration of the application of GIS technology within GRID to combine global and national datasets for resource management and environmental planning applications at the national level in a number of demonstration case studies; Establishment of a framework for cooperation and data exchange between international and inter-governmental organizations which deal with environment-related matters, such as FAO, WHO, WMO, ICSU, ILCA, IUCN, etc, and, Provision of exposure to GIS technology and of training opportunities in GIS and data management technologies employed by GRID to scientists and resource managers from participating developing countries.
